What Is Smart Home Technology?

Smart home technology connects devices and appliances to the internet. Users control these devices through smartphones, tablets, or voice assistants like Alexa and Google Home. Common smart home tech includes thermostats, lighting systems, security cameras, door locks, and kitchen appliances.

These devices communicate with each other through Wi-Fi, Bluetooth, or specialized protocols like Zigbee and Z-Wave. A central hub often coordinates the system, though many modern devices work independently.

Smart home tech lets homeowners automate routines. Lights can turn on at sunset. Thermostats learn preferred temperatures and adjust automatically. Security systems send alerts directly to phones. This level of control was impossible with traditional setups just a decade ago.

The smart home tech market has grown rapidly. Statista reports that over 60 million U.S. households used smart home devices in 2023. That number continues to climb as prices drop and installation becomes simpler.

Key Differences Between Smart and Traditional Systems

The smart home tech vs traditional systems debate comes down to several factors: control, connectivity, cost, and maintenance.

Control and Automation

Traditional systems require manual operation. Homeowners flip switches, turn dials, and physically adjust settings. Smart home tech automates these tasks. Users set schedules, create triggers, and control everything remotely.

Connectivity

Traditional systems work independently. A standard thermostat controls heat, nothing else. Smart home tech creates an ecosystem. Devices share data and respond to each other. When someone unlocks a smart door, the lights can turn on and the alarm can disarm simultaneously.

Installation and Setup

Traditional systems are straightforward. An electrician installs a light switch, and it works for decades. Smart home tech requires more setup. Users must connect devices to networks, download apps, and configure settings. Some smart devices need professional installation.

Maintenance Requirements

Traditional systems rarely need updates. They operate until parts wear out. Smart home tech requires regular software updates, battery replacements for wireless devices, and occasional troubleshooting when connectivity fails.

Upfront and Long-Term Costs

Traditional systems cost less initially. A basic thermostat runs $20 to $50. A smart thermostat costs $100 to $300. But, smart home tech can reduce energy bills over time. The U.S. Department of Energy estimates that smart thermostats save homeowners 8% on heating and cooling costs annually.

Pros and Cons of Smart Home Tech

Understanding the advantages and disadvantages of smart home tech helps homeowners make informed decisions.

Advantages

Energy Efficiency: Smart thermostats, lights, and appliances optimize energy use. They turn off when not needed and adjust based on occupancy patterns.

Convenience: Control everything from one app. Forgot to lock the door? Check and lock it from anywhere. Want to preheat the oven on the drive home? Done.

Security: Smart cameras, doorbells, and locks provide real-time monitoring. Motion alerts, video recording, and remote access give homeowners peace of mind.

Accessibility: Voice control helps people with mobility issues operate devices without physical effort. Smart home tech makes independent living easier for seniors and those with disabilities.

Increased Home Value: Homes with smart technology often sell faster and at higher prices. Buyers appreciate move-in-ready automation.

Disadvantages

Higher Initial Cost: Smart devices cost more upfront than traditional alternatives. A full smart home setup can run thousands of dollars.

Internet Dependence: Most smart home tech requires internet access. Outages disable remote features and automation.

Privacy Concerns: Connected devices collect data. Cameras and microphones raise questions about security and who has access to recordings.

Compatibility Issues: Not all smart devices work together. Different brands use different protocols, which can limit integration options.

Learning Curve: Some users find setup and operation confusing. Older homeowners may prefer simpler traditional systems.

When to Choose Traditional Home Systems

Smart home tech isn’t the right fit for everyone. Traditional systems make sense in several situations.

Budget Constraints: Homeowners with limited budgets benefit from traditional systems. A basic security system costs a fraction of a smart alternative. Savings add up across multiple devices.

Unreliable Internet: Rural areas and locations with spotty connectivity pose challenges for smart home tech. Traditional systems work without internet. They don’t fail during outages or slowdowns.

Simplicity Preference: Some people want their home to just work. No apps. No updates. No troubleshooting. Traditional systems deliver this straightforward experience.

Rental Properties: Renters may not want to invest in smart devices they can’t take with them. Landlords might not allow modifications. Traditional systems come standard in most rentals.

Privacy Priority: Users concerned about data collection and hacking prefer traditional systems. No connected device means no digital vulnerabilities.

The smart home tech vs traditional systems choice often depends on lifestyle. A tech-savvy homeowner who travels frequently benefits from remote monitoring. A retiree who rarely leaves home might find traditional controls perfectly adequate.
